Grammy-winning Nigerian artist Burna Boy has released his highly anticipated eighth studio album, No Sign of Weakness. Leading the album’s debut is his new single, “Sweet Love,” accompanied by a vibrant music video. The track, produced by Major Seven, delivers a romantic reggae feel infused with Burna Boy’s distinctive global sound and melodic pop appeal.
“Sweet Love” builds on the success of the album’s earlier release, “Update.” A collaboration with producer P2J, the song features a sample from Soul II Soul’s classic track, “Back to Life,” creating a fusion of Afrobeats and club-ready energy. Its music video, enriched with visuals that reflect the album’s central themes, has already garnered over 5 million views on YouTube.
Also included on the album is fan-favorite “Bundle By Bundle,” produced by Telz. This high-energy track has racked up over 24 million streams on Spotify and 8.5 million video views. Critics from Billboard, NME, and UPROXX have praised it as a homage to nightlife culture and Burna Boy’s commanding musical style.
Recently, Burna collaborated on a remix of Joé Dwèt Filé’s hit “4 Kampé,” blending Afrobeats with Haitian Kompa to create a globally celebrated anthem. Earlier this year, he made history as the first African artist to headline a sold-out show at the Stade de France, coinciding with his feature as Billboard France’s first cover star. His global stadium tour continues this summer with headline performances in Berlin and Mönchengladbach, with more dates to follow.
